Menus and recipes for budget family cooking, plus a bit of wittering as is my wont. Thursday, 22 January 2015. Butternut quinoa cashew pilaf. Very quick and easy and tasty way to use a butternut squash. Peel and dice a butternut squash and fry in a little olive oil with one finely chopped onion and a teaspoon of cumin seeds. Menus and recipes for budget family cooking, plus a bit of wittering as is my wont. Friday, 4 April 2014. Breakfast bite flapjack morsels. Another end of cereal packet recipe. You may recall I pour the dregs and crumbs and powder of a pack of breakfast cereal, be it muesli, granola or branflakes, into a medium lock and lock and store until I can use it.
